Program Details
Business Education Foundations Certificate of Achievement
New Program
Business Administration (050500)
08/01/22
This certificate provides students with the core of courses that constitute foundational business knowledge and skills for the various associates degrees offered in Business as well as for transfer to a bachelor’s or other advanced degree program. The jobs for which this certificate prepares students include entry level office clerks, accounting assistants, production assistants, office assistants, recreation assistants, audio and video equipment assistants, billing and posting clerks, assistants to administrative services managers, construction managers, cost estimators, general and operations managers, industrial production managers, management analysts, sales managers, social and community service managers, transportation, storage, and distribution managers, other managers, and many others across a wide range of industries.

The conversation about stacking of awards has been a continuing one in the business department. The recent reduction in our local general education requirements gave further impetus to expansion of our “core + stacking” or “strategic stacking” approach. The courses in this certificate constitute a foundation of business knowledge and skills required for most of our degrees, with the exception of the ADT, giving students greater opportunity to complete more than one award or to switch awards without having to enroll in a completely different set of courses. Furthermore, this set of courses provides a solid and consistent foundation in business regardless of a student’s chosen specialty.

Course | Title | Units | Year/Semester (Y1 or S1) |
---|---|---|---|
BUS1 or BUS1H | Intro to Business | 3 | Y1 |
BUS13 or BUS13H | Legal Environment and Business Law | 3 | Y1 |
BUS104 | Business Communications | 3 | Y1 |
CWE180 or BUS196 | Coop Work Exp or Workplace Success Skills | 1 | Y1 |
Electives | Various | 3-4 | Y2 |
